BIO:

Monica Thi is a Chinese-Canadian creative director and video editor based in Toronto, Canada. Through her colourful work, Monica creates with the intention of weaving the fabric of memories and emotions by crafting ethereal and dreamlike worlds for the audience to exist in.

Monica’s philosophy of work is to viscerally capture a quality of empathy - something that is said poetically but with the soul and grit of imperfection that feels human when you see it. Her personal art often explores themes of East Asian diaspora, reflective memory, the essence of youth, and the tapestry of identity.

Monica's strong background in film and design, coupled with her extensive experience in brand development, marketing, and creative direction, positions her to bridge the synergy between artistic vision and commercial success, harmonizing both the conceptual and technical streams seamlessly.

Notably, her recent commercial and video projects have garnered awards, premieres, and nominations, including recognition at the Berlin Commercial Festival (Video, 2023), NOWNESS ASIA, RBC MVP Prism Prize and is a Bronze Recipient for the 2023 ADCC Awards (The Advertising & Design Club of Canada). Most recently, her latest public exhibition was for Toronto’s Year Of Public Art (2021 - 2022) for her film series “Around The Corner, Behind The Sun.” Her films have been screened at festivals such as the New York City Women's International Film Festival, The Toronto Film Review, screened at the TIFF Bell Lightbox, whilst also winning the Best Production Design Award and Best Editing Award at Cinesiege hosted at Hot Docs Ted Rogers Cinema.

Monica's favourite films are Bi Gan's Long Days Journey Into Night, Makoto Shinkai's Your Name, Dean Fleischer Camp's Marcel The Shell with Shoes On, and Hirokazu Kore-eda's After The Storm.
